HSP60和HSP70在严重烧伤大鼠胃黏膜的表达及对胃黏膜的保护作用

摘    要:目的观察严重烧伤大鼠胃黏膜热休克蛋白60和70(HSP60、HSP70)的表达变化及热休克预处理(HS)对严重烧伤大鼠胃黏膜的影响,探讨热休克预处理诱导HSP60、HSP70过量表达后对严重烧伤大鼠胃黏膜的保护作用。方法将Wistar大鼠随机分为2大组:①烧伤组(B组)40只大鼠烧伤后即制作急性胃黏膜损伤模型;另取8只大鼠不烧伤,作为正常对照组(伤前);②HS+烧伤组(HB组)40只大鼠于烧伤前20 h行HS,另取8只大鼠只行HS不烧伤,作为实验对照组(伤前)。各组于伤后3、6、12、24、48 h处死大鼠(B组、HB组每时相点8只大鼠),留取标本检测胃黏膜损伤指数(UI)、HSP60、HSP70的变化,并进行相关分析。结果大鼠严重烧伤后胃黏膜HSP60、HSP70表达迅速升高,随后开始下降,伤后24 h降至最低,此时胃黏膜损伤程度最严重(UI=12.74±1.92)。HB组大鼠较B组大鼠HSP60、HSP70表达均显著增强,胃黏膜损伤程度则明显减轻(P<0.05或P<0.01)。UI与HSP70呈显著负相关(r=-0.794,P<0.05),UI与HSP60无相关性(r=-0.625,P>0.05)。结论热...

The Expressions of Heat Shock Proteins 60 and 70 and Their Protective Effect on the Gastric Mucosa of Burned Rats

Abstract:Objective To observe the changes of the expressions of heat shock proteins(HSP) 60 and 70 in the gastric mucosa of burned rats and the effect of heat shock preconditioning(HS) on the gastric mucosa of burned rats in order to explore the protection of HSP 60 and 70.MethodsNinety-six wistar rats were divided randomly into two groups:(1)burn group(n=40,burned and then being made into the model of acute gastric mucosal lesion)and another 8 normal rats without burn were employed as blank control(preburn);(2)HB g...
